Output ef12ad180dde167baec4829c0a56a6aae2dbd8fe3dbc1a9f6c490ae02dae8ecb:144

value
40834911
script pubkey
OP_0 OP_PUSHBYTES_20 148dd3b656a74a8150b1cb598d748b95e02a340e
address
bc1qzjxa8djk5a9gz593edvc6aytjhsz5dqw7cnf4y
transaction
ef12ad180dde167baec4829c0a56a6aae2dbd8fe3dbc1a9f6c490ae02dae8ecb
confirmations
85144
spent
true